Inspired by this thread, I sorted a couple of bullet batches, from two different moulds, 170- 180 grs .30 cal bullets. Most of the bullets were within 1 grain. But I had outliers, both light and heavy. The light ones were either shiny (to cold mould), or frosty with slightly rounded driving bands (to hot mould). The heavies had parting lines from the mould halves, and increased diameter (slack handle pressure).
It was no surprise to me, that my casting technique had quite a potential for improvement
But now I have a clear idea what to work with. Great!
